We report a rare case of soft tissue chondroma of the hard palate with a review of the literature. A 59-year-old man was referred to our department because of a symptomatic mass on the median anterior margin of the hard palate of 4 year's duration. The lesion was approximately 15<!--> <!-->mm<!--> <!-->×<!--> <!-->10<!--> <!-->mm<!--> <!-->×<!--> <!-->8<!--> <!-->mm in size and pedunculated. The lesion was excised under local anesthesia, and the pathological diagnosis was soft tissue chondroma. The histopathological findings suggested that the heterotopic formation of cartilage was caused by the metaplastic change of mesenchymal cells into chondrocytes. Similarities between BRONJ and infected osteonecrosis (ION) with no history of BPs use have been described. The aim of this study is to compare the light microscopical findings of two lesions, especially in the histomorphologic analysis of osteoclasts. We investigated eight patients with intravenous BPs treatment and osteonecrosis, and seven patients suffering from ION with no history of BPs use. {"title":"Surgical management of chondroblastoma involving the temporal bone and mandible: Case report","authors":"Ikuya Miyamoto ,&nbsp;Yumiko Togo ,&nbsp;Kenji Osawa ,&nbsp;Shinya Yasuda","doi":"10.1016/j.ajoms.2010.12.003","DOIUrl":"10.1016/j.ajoms.2010.12.003","url":null,"abstract":"<div><p>Chondroblastoma is a rare benign cartilaginous neoplasm that typically arises in the epiphysis of long bones. Chondroblastoma in the maxillofacial area is quite rare; and approximately 80 cases of chondroblastoma involving the temporal bone have been reported worldwide. Furthermore, only nine cases of chondroblastoma involving the mandibular condyle have been reported. A 68-year-old female presented with mild hearing loss, trismus, and swelling in the left temporal region. Computed tomography and magnetic resonance imaging revealed a round, solid 60<!--> <!-->mm lesion with significant osseous destruction of the petrous and squamous regions of the temporal bone. Histological examination of the biopsy specimen revealed a chondroblastoma. The final clinical diagnosis was chondroblastoma involving the dura and condylar head of the mandible. Total excision of the tumour was undertaken via a combined neurosurgical and oral surgical approach. The patient's post-operative course was uneventful, however, she had dysesthesia in the distribution of the mandibular nerve, and temporary paresis of the frontotemporal branch of the facial nerve. The dysesthesia improved within 1 year but very mild facial palsy continued. Recent studies have suggested that determination of the expression of cytokeratin 13 and 17 would be useful for the early diagnosis of oral squamous cell carcinoma. In this study, we focused on the diagnosis based on the malignant potential of epithelial dysplasia and evaluated the feasibility of combined assessment of cytokeratin 13 and 17.</p></div><div><h3>Patients and methods</h3><p>The expression of cytokeratin 13 and 17 observed in 8 patients with clinically diagnosed T1 or T2 tongue squamous cell carcinoma was analyzed using real-time PCR and immunohistochemical staining of resected specimens. Areas in each specimen were identified as Normal, Dysplasia and Cancer.</p></div><div><h3>Results</h3><p>Real-time PCR showed that the expression of cytokeratin 13 decreased beginning with Dysplasia, whereas the expression of cytokeratin 17 increased beginning with Dysplasia. Immunohistochemical staining revealed that cytokeratin 13-positive cells decreased beginning with Dysplasia, while there were almost no cytokeratin 13-positive cells in Cancer. Conversely, cytokeratin 17-positive cells increased beginning with Dysplasia, and almost all cells were cytokeratin 17-positive in Cancer. This unusual disease is actually attributed to pulmonary and haemodynamic changes engendered by high negative intra-thoracic pressures during the state of obstructed respiration. We report a case of postoperative pulmonary oedema in a previously healthy 35-year-old female with post-extubation laryngospasm. The patient responded rapidly to conservative management including removal of secretions, re-intubation, oxygen therapy with positive pressure ventilation and administration of diuretics with short term antibiotics. The pathognomonic histopathologic feature is the presence of spherical ossicles, which are similar to psammoma bodies. Very few cases in association with secondary aneurysmal bone cyst (ABC) formation have been reported in the literature. Treatment consists of complete surgical removal and incomplete excision has been associated with a high local recurrence rate. The prognosis is good because malignant change and metastasis have not been reported.
